At the same time, it has been possible to engage in amiable discussions of how the facility might, for example, correct the inappropriate practices observed. 3.5.3 INFORMATION ACTIVITIES A brochure on the NPM activities has been published and is currently available in Finnish, Swedish, English, Estonian and Russian. It will also be translated into other languages, if necessary. The reports on the inspection visits conducted by the NPM have been published on the Ombudsman’s external website since the beginning of 2018. The NPM has enhanced its communications on visits and related matters in the social media. 3.5.4 EDUCATION AND TRAINING ON FUNDAMENTAL AND HUMAN RIGHTS In order to promote human rights education and training, The Ombudsman and the Human Rights Centre started a joint project in 2017. The project is particularly targeted at the educational sector. The goal of the project and the inspection visits is to assess and promote education and training on basic and human rights at all levels of school life. Based on the experiences gained during the visits, the project team produced a training package for municipal directors of education and headmasters. In 2018, the NPM initiated a joint project with the Human Rights Centre on the realisation of fundamental and human rights in housing services for the disabled. In preparation for the project, experts employed by the Human Rights Centre have participated in visits of service units for disabled people. 74 3.5.5 TRAINING The Office of the Parliamentary Ombudsman provided training related to the duties of the NPM as follows: – National patient ombudsman days / NPM inspection visits of health care units.
